#4b686b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4b686b is composed of 29.4% red, 40.8% green and 42%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29.9% cyan, 2.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 58% black. It has a hue angle of 185.6 degrees, a saturation of 17.6% and a lightness of 35.7%. #4b686b color hex could be obtained by blending #96d0d6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

Shades and Tints of #4b686b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020303 is the darkest color, while #f7f9f9 is the lightest one.
